The ICC Champions Trophy 2025 is about to happen between February 19 and March 9, bringing collectively eight of the world’s prime cricketing nations in a high-stakes battle for the coveted title. The event might be performed within the 50-over format and might be hosted collectively by Pakistan and the United Arab Emirates (UAE).
ICC Champions Trophy 2025: A historic event set to unfold
This version is especially historic as it would mark Pakistan’s first time internet hosting an ICC world occasion because the 1996 ODI World Cup. Because of safety considerations, particularly concerning India‘s participation, a portion of the matches, might be held in Dubai. The ninth version of the Champions Trophy will see the highest eight groups from the ICC ODI World Cup 2023 – together with hosts Pakistan – compete throughout 15 thrilling matches, unfold throughout varied venues in Pakistan and the UAE. The event’s return after an eight-year hiatus has generated immense pleasure, with followers eagerly awaiting the revival of this prestigious competitors.
Shikhar Dhawan picks the winner between India and Pakistan
Essentially the most extremely anticipated fixture of the Champions Trophy would be the encounter between India and Pakistan on Sunday, February 23, on the Dubai Worldwide Cricket Stadium. Every time these two cricketing powerhouses meet, the stakes are huge, the environment electrifying, and the feelings intense. Given the historic rivalry, political backdrop, and the rarity of their encounters outdoors ICC occasions, this match might be one of many most-watched sporting occasions globally.
Forward of this high-voltage conflict, former India opener Shikhar Dhawan shared his ideas on the encounter. Chatting with the Occasions of India (TOI), Dhawan mirrored on the unparalleled depth of an India-Pakistan match. He emphasised how these contests carry an unmatched vitality, making them an honor to take part in. He expressed confidence in India’s potential to carry out effectively, stating that he believes the Indian group will come out victorious.
“The India vs Pakistan rivalry is at all times particular. There’s a singular depth to those video games – a lot vitality, so many emotions- it’s a rivalry like no different. Representing India and taking part in in opposition to Pakistan is an absolute honor, and the environment on the sphere is not like something I’ve skilled. Each second feels greater due to the rivalry, and it’s a type of matches that each participant seems to be ahead to with nice pleasure. I’m positive India will provide you with flying colours,” Shikhar mentioned.
Dhawan, who performed a vital function in India’s Champions Trophy 2013 victory beneath MS Dhoni, was named Participant of the Event for his stellar performances. The left-handed opener amassed 363 runs in 5 matches, averaging an astonishing 90.75, with two centuries and a fifty. His contributions performed a key function in India’s unbeaten marketing campaign.

Head-to-Head: India vs Pakistan in ICC tournaments
India have traditionally dominated Pakistan in ICC World Cups, sustaining a 100% win file in ODI World Cups (8-0) and profitable seven of their eight encounters in T20 World Cups, with Pakistan’s solely victory coming in Dubai in 2021. Nevertheless, the Champions Trophy tells a distinct story, the place Pakistan leads 3-2 in head-to-head battles. In 2004 and 2009, Pakistan received the group-stage encounters, establishing an early benefit. India responded with dominant victories in 2013 and 2017, leveling the file.
Nevertheless, Pakistan registered a commanding 180-run win within the 2017 ultimate, a match that continues to be one in all their best victories in ICC historical past. Fakhar Zaman’s match-winning century and Mohammad Amir’s devastating opening spell in opposition to India’s prime order sealed Pakistan’s second ICC Champions Trophy title. This stays Pakistan’s solely ICC trophy win over India, including further motivation for India to settle scores within the upcoming version.
